《物聯網通信技術》課件-第三章 RS485通信_第1頁
《物聯網通信技術》課件-第三章 RS485通信_第2頁
《物聯網通信技術》課件-第三章 RS485通信_第3頁
《物聯網通信技術》課件-第三章 RS485通信_第4頁
《物聯網通信技術》課件-第三章 RS485通信_第5頁
已閱讀5頁,還剩33頁未讀 繼續免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

物聯網通信技術3-1RS485協議概述第三章RS485通信如何設計485電路?01RS485總線匹配電阻02RS485收發器電路設計03保護電路設計二、RS485收發器電路設計二、RS485收發器電路設計A:差分正輸入端B:差分負輸入端RO:接收端DI:發送端RE:接收使能端DE:發送使能端A:通過上拉電阻接電源B:通過下拉電阻接地DI:接單片機串口發送引腳RO:接單片機串口接收引腳RE和DE:接單片機普通IO引腳二、RS485收發器電路設計二、RS485收發器電路設計二、RS485收發器電路設計1001三、保護電路設計三、保護電路設計RS485總線電路設計低速率短距離可用簡單設計多設備長距離高速率要加保護和隔離思考題1嵌入式開發SPI接口,每次傳輸的數據是多少位?為什么?2請同學們根據介紹的SPI接口應用,實現溫度采集。物聯網通信技術3-2RS485電路設計第三章RS485通信搭建好硬件環境如何實現數據的傳輸?知識回顧RS485總線對電氣進行了標準規定,數據傳輸是軟件層,常采用ModbusRTU模式。01串口助手調測RS485設備02RS485驅動程序開發一、串口助手調測RS485設備通信基本參數一、串口助手調測RS485設備Modbus-RTU通信規約問詢幀地址1個字節功能碼1個字節起始地址2個字節數據2個字節CRC校驗高位1個字節0x010x030x00020x00020xCB應答幀地址1個字節功能碼1個字節返回有效字節數

2個字節光照度高字節2個字節光照度低字節2個字節CRC校驗高位2個字節0x010x030x00040x00000xdd400xA293二、RS485驅動程序開發時鐘PD7發送接收使能引腳PA2、PA3串口引腳二、RS485驅動程序開發串口基本配置中斷配置二、RS485驅動程序開發t:用作循環次數發送使能發送關閉,接收使能數據發送RS485發送驅動函數二、RS485驅動程序開發res:緩存接收的數據接收數據寄存器不是空三、小結介紹了RS485軟件協議和驅動開發,可自定義協議,如果是主從多連接也可以通過Modbus-RTU通信規約進行通信。驅動程序的開發主要包括發送驅動和接收驅動兩部分,主要是串行口的通信開發,RS485增加了發送和接收使能控制,且默認狀態是接收狀態。階段總結思考題1在驅動程序中為什么把默認態設置為接收狀態?2請根據驅動開發編寫一個RS485設備的程序。物聯網通信技術3-3RS485嵌入式開發實踐第三章RS485通信RS485如何實現數據的收發01RS485的差分原理02RS485特性03RS485總線拓撲結構一、RS485的差分原理28一.RS485的差分原理抗干擾能力強

時序定位精確設備1485設備2AB485一、RS485的差分原理29一.RS485的差分原理抗干擾能力強

時序定位精確無干擾:(DT)=(D+)-(D-)有干擾:(DT)=[(D+)+Noise]-[(D-)+Noise]=(D+)-(D-)二、RS485特性電氣特性TTL電平邏輯0:小于0.4V邏輯1:

大于2.4VRS485電平邏輯0:兩線間的電壓差+(2-6)V邏輯1:

兩線間的電壓差-(2-6)V從RS485接口到負載,數據所允許的最大電纜長度與信號傳輸的波特率成反比。二、RS485特性最長傳輸距離1200米,可增加8個中繼。傳輸距離:最大傳輸速率10Mbps。傳輸速率:二、RS485總線拓撲結構手拉手--鏈條式ABC二、RS485總線拓撲結構星型樹型三、RS485總線拓撲結構?????

RS485總線的差分原理和優勢,RS485總線的特性及網絡拓撲結構。RS485總線在工控領域應用非

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業或盈利用途。
  • 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論